Name

The first proposal for a Cathedral dedicated to the "Romanian People's Salvation" arose in 1990. Every Eastern Orthodox church is usually dedicated to a saint, but the cathedral is currently only known for its dedication to the salvation of the Romanian people. Archbishop Bartolomeu Anania explained the name by saying that a nation is not just a "socio-historical reality", but also a "metaphysical, religious and theological reality" and that salvation must be obtained collectively, by the whole nation.
